G749 LWP is a 1990 Lancia Delta in Black with a 1,995c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 16 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 81.3%.
Across all 1990 Lancia Delta models, the average MOT pass rate is 73.6% with a typical mileage of 109,530 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Lancia Delta fails its MOT is suspension component mounting prescribed area is excessively corroded, accounting for 825 recorded failures. If you're considering buying G749 LWP,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Lancia Delta typically stays on UK roads for around 39 years. At 36 years old, this Lancia Delta is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
